Saratoga Cancels Sunday Program

The New York Racing Association, Inc. (NYRA) announced that there will be no live racing at Saratoga Race Course on Sunday, August 28. Live racing at Saratoga is expected to resume Monday, August 29.
The Grade 1 Personal Ensign, originally scheduled for Sunday, will be re-drawn on Wednesday, August 31 and run Saturday, September 3 on a card that will also include the Grade 1 Woodward and Grade 1 Forego.
Additionally, as earlier announced, there will be no simulcasting at either Aqueduct Racetrack or the Belmont Café on Sunday.
